I am a certified Qigong Teacher as well as a Somatic psychotherapist. Somatic psychotherapy is a holistic approach driven by the latest research in neuroscience. It works with the dynamic patterns between the body & the mind and is considered one of the best approaches to work with anxiety and trauma.
Through embodied awareness, we learn to notice & transform patterns & beliefs that are remnants from our past. Transforming these patterns on a fundamental level frees us up to make healthier choices based on present life experience.

Preventing Burn-out: Qigong 4 Health Professionals
Surrounded by those who are suffering, health professionals give not only their skills but also their inner resources, often absorbing others' pain. Over time, many of us feel depleted, and our health and the quality of our lives can be affected. Qigong is a form of still and moving meditation that can restore your energy reserves & quiet your mind. Mindfulness based practices can help you regulate your nervous system, align your mind-body-& spirt, and help you settle into a more relaxed way of being.
